Any Assistance would be greatly appreciated regarding this matter.

I seem to be getting some serious stuttering when I use the in game communications.  Any time I use the range or channel I get some stuttering.  I have tried everything from total ground up vista re-install, drivers, etc. etc.  The interesting thing is this happens in offline training aswell.  I have ping plotted and everything and network looks good.  This was not an issue until patch 8.  Also, I am noticing more frequent app hangs.  This was not an issue with 7.

Im just at wits end here and have been messing with this computer way too much for one game.  This program is the only one I seem to have problems with.  I am glad that HiTech is working to improve the product and I am greatful, but I am spending more time trying to get it working then playing.  Attached is dx diag.

PTT issue has been resolved!  I talked with a gentleman at Hi tech and was able to resolve the issue.  Seems that the USB headsets were conflicted.  I was able to resolve this and at least offline works.  I am going to reload to the latest nvidia drivers and see what happens.  Cheers again Hi tech.
